Inside hours following insertion, the ET is promptly colonized by microorganisms forming a biofilm on its surface. Making use of scanning electron microscopy, Yan et al. evaluated biofilms formed around the surface of ET after initiating ventilation for two days and observed that biofilms covered a higher percentage (87.five ) of ETs following 70 days. Tomato (Solanum lycopersicon L.) is among the most significant vegetable crops on the planet, ranking second just after potato. The fruits are great dietary sources of minerals, fibers, vitamins, and quite a few antioxidants, principally the distinctive red pigment lycopene (1).
